dc.description.abstractObjective:The objective of this study is to review the exposure limits in the legislation, guidelines, and standards for human vibration in Korea. Background: There have been relatively less interests in vibration than other risk factors in Korea. However, the importance of vibration is increasing as industry and everyday life are more mechanized. Method: Various enforcements were examined including legislation, guidelines, and standards for whole-body vibration and localized vibration. Results: No exposure limits were found in legislation, guidelines, and standards for the human vibration in Korea. Conclusion: It is important to introduce new duties regarding vibration risks to the general duties. Further studies are expected on the vibration exposure limits appropriate for Korean people and job conditions. Application: The results from this study would be of help to induce more interests in human vibration to the occupational health and safety professionals of Korea.-
